The Use of Animated Film Media to Improve the Ability of Writing Short Stories in Elementary School Nanda Saputra; Irnie Victorynie; Syarifah Rahmi; Syarifah Siregar; Dina Komalasari; Suhendi Syam
Budapest International Research and Critics Institute-Journal (BIRCI-Journal) Vol 4, No 2 (2021): Budapest International Research and Critics Institute May
Publisher : Budapest International Research and Critics University

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.33258/birci.v4i2.2013

Abstract

This research originated from the low skills of grade IV SDN (public school) 1 Sigli students in writing short stories. Learning media to write short stories is an alternative means of delivering material to students through animated film media. This study aims to determine the improvement of short story writing skills using animated film media in fourth grade students of SDN 1 Sigli. This research is a classroom action research (CAR) which was conducted in three cycles. Each cycle consists of four stages, namely planning, implementing, observing, and reflecting. The subjects of this study were 24 students of grade IV SDN 1 Sigli, consisting of 12 female students and 12 male students. The data collection technique was done by using tests, observations, and field notes. The data analysis used was a comparative descriptive analysis technique. The results of data analysis showed that the acquisition of student learning outcomes with an average value in cycle I: 60%, cycle II: 80%, and cycle III: 91%. Thus it can be concluded, the use of animated film media can improve students' short story writing skills, and teachers always improve their skills in using instructional media. This can be seen from the cycles obtained by students in each cycle.
Implementation of Online Learning Using Online Media, During the Covid 19 Pandemic Nanda Saputra; Nurul Hikmah; Via Yustitia; Miswar Saputra; Abdul Wahab; Junaedi Junaedi
Budapest International Research and Critics Institute-Journal (BIRCI-Journal) Vol 4, No 2 (2021): Budapest International Research and Critics Institute May
Publisher : Budapest International Research and Critics University

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.33258/birci.v4i2.1857

Abstract

Due to outbreak of the Covid 19, the implementation of education and learning has extremely changed. Face to face meetings as a conventional learning is no longer conducted, in contrast, online learning is more often employed. Thus, a solution to this problem is required to respond to this problem. Online learning is an alternative that can overcome this problem. The purpose of this research is to get a reflection of the implementation of online education by using online media to reduce the outbreak of Covid-19 in universities. The research subjects were PGMI students who were interviewed through Zoom Cloud Meeting to collect the data. The data analysis employed was an interactive analysis method Miles & Huberman. The results of the research showed that: (1) the students had already had the basic facilities needed to explore online education; (2) the online education was flexibly being implemented, encouraging learning independently, motivating to learn more actively; and (3) long distance education urges the students to get used to social distancing attitude and minimizes crowds to reduce the outbreak of Covid-19 in institutions tertiary. The lack of supervision of students, lack of internet signals in remote areas, and high quota payments were challenges in online education. The increasing of independent learning, attention, motivation, and the courage to express ideas and problems was another advantage of online education.

PENGARUH MEDIA PEMBELAJARAN KOMIK TERHADAP KETERAMPILAN BERCERITA BAHASA INDONESIA SISWA KELAS III JATICEMPAKA VI BEKASI Nanda Saputra; Septi Fitri Meilana
JURNAL EKSPERIMENTAL : Media Ilmiah Pendidikan Guru Madrasah Ibtidaiyah Vol. 9 No. 2 (2020): Desember
Publisher : Sekolah Tinggi Ilmu Tarbiyah Al-Hilal Sigli Aceh- Indonesia

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.58645/eksperimental.v9i2.136

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of comic learning media on Indonesian language storytelling skills of 3th grade students. This research is a quantitative study using the Quasy Experimental type of research method with the type of The Nonequivalent Posttest-Only Control Group Design. The population of this study included all 3th grade students of SDN Jaticempaka VI in the second semester of the 2020/2021 school year. The sample studied was 32 students from class III A and class III B. The sampling technique used a saturated sampling model. The research instrument was a description of 6 questions. The data analysis technique consists of two stages of data distribution on the results of students' storytelling skills and hypothesis testing includes the t-test by seeing the differences in storytelling skills in the experimental class and the control class with a significant level of 0.05%. Based on the results of the post-test, it was found that the average score of students' storytelling skills after being taught using comic media (experimental class) was higher than the average score for storytelling skills of students who did not use comic media (control class). The average post-test score of the experimental class was 96 and the control class 82.
Gizi Seimbang dari Dapur Nusantara : Edukasi dan Berbagi Bubur Manado di RT.01, Kelurahan Selumit Nurul Hidayat; Gea Dilah Hermila; Muhammad Chaidir; Maria Deslianti Suryani Katim; Nanda Saputra; Noni Haironi; Sindy Arismawati Hasan; Yuniati Yuniati
Jurnal Kemitraan Masyarakat Vol. 2 No. 2 (2025): Jurnal Kemitraan Masyarakat
Publisher : Lembaga Pengembangan Kinerja Dosen

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.62383/jkm.v2i2.1439

Abstract

The "Balanced Nutrition from the Archipelago’s Kitchen" initiative is an educational and practical effort aimed at increasing community awareness of the importance of consuming balanced nutritious foods through a local culinary approach. This program was conducted in RT.01, Selumit Urban Village, focusing on nutrition education and the distribution of Bubur Manado (Manado porridge) as an example of a healthy traditional dish. The methods included nutrition counseling, cooking demonstrations, and food distribution to residents. The results showed improved community understanding of balanced nutrition concepts and greater appreciation for traditional Indonesian cuisine as a source of nutritious food. This activity also fostered a sense of solidarity and cooperation among community members. It is hoped that similar programs can serve as a sustainable model for culturally based nutrition education in other communities.

Upaya Peningkatan Status Gizi Anak Melalui Program Posyandu Balita "Anggrek Merah" Kelurahan Karang Anyar Pantai Nurul Hidayat; Gea Dilah Hermila; Jesika Dela Maharani; Fahrul Ilham Muhti; Owen Petit; Prithi Arvana Angody; Febrianingsih. A; Nanda Saputra
Karya Nyata : Jurnal Pengabdian kepada Masyarakat Vol. 2 No. 4 (2025): Desember : Karya Nyata : Jurnal Pengabdian kepada Masyarakat
Publisher : Lembaga Pengembangan Kinerja Dosen

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.62951/karyanyata.v2i4.2572

Abstract

Nutritional problems in toddlers remain a public health challenge in Indonesia, including in Tarakan City, North Kalimantan. The 2018 Basic Health Research (Riskesdas) data shows a high prevalence of malnutrition, severe malnutrition, and stunting in toddlers, with data showing that based on the body weight index (BB/A) the prevalence of malnourished toddlers is 3.9% while 13.8% of toddlers are undernourished. Based on the height-for-age (H/A) index, there are 11.5% of toddlers with very short nutritional status and 19.3% of toddlers with stunted nutritional status. Meanwhile, based on the weight-for-height (BB/H) index, the proportion of very wasted children is 3.5%, undernourished children are 6.7%, and overweight children are 8% (Riskesdas, 2018). Because of these problems, early nutrition education efforts are needed. This community service activity aims to increase the knowledge of toddler mothers about the importance of balanced nutrition for children, especially through the use of UHT milk as a nutritional supplement, as well as strengthening the role of integrated health posts (Posyandu) in monitoring child growth and development. Thus, this community service activity contributes to raising public awareness of the importance of meeting toddler nutritional needs and is expected to support government programs to reduce the prevalence of stunting in Tarakan City.
Guru di Era Generasi Alpha: Studi Kasus Pada SD Negeri 87 Palembang Nanda Saputra; Edi Harapan; Muhammad Fahmi
Khatulistiwa: Jurnal Pendidikan dan Sosial Humaniora Vol. 6 No. 1 (2026): Maret : Khatulistiwa: Jurnal Pendidikan dan Sosial Humaniora
Publisher : Pusat Riset dan Inovasi Nasional

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.55606/khatulistiwa.v6i1.8547

Abstract

The rapid development of digital technology has given rise to Generation Alpha, a generation familiar from birth with gadgets, the internet, and a fast-paced and practical environment. This situation requires teachers to adapt to the mindsets, learning styles, and needs of students to ensure learning remains relevant and effective. This study aims to describe the roles, strategies, and challenges of teachers in dealing with Generation Alpha at Public Elementary School 87 Palembang. The research method used was a qualitative case study approach, through observation, interviews, and documentation. The results indicate that teachers are required to be more creative, innovative, and technologically literate in delivering material, while simultaneously building student character through interactive and collaborative learning. The main challenge faced by teachers is maintaining a balance between the use of technology and the development of discipline, empathy, and ethics in students. Thus, the role of teachers in the Generation Alpha era is not only as transmitters of knowledge, but also as facilitators, motivators, and role models in building the competencies and character of the future generation.
